Modern technology is complex. It takes hundreds of thousands of people to develop and build the components in a state-of-the-art smartphone. Electronics are getting so sophisticated that it is not surprising many people are confused about what modern phones are actually capable of. Today I want to focus on mobile phone location tracking: How phones can be tracked in practice, what is theoretically possible but also common misconceptions. When we think about who might want to track a phone, usually three types of entities come to mind: Governments and law enforcement, companies and individuals. All of them have different resources which determines the type of location tracking they are capable of. The types of tracking highlighted in this video are by no means exhaustive, also many of the technologies arent freely available which means the academic literature on them might be based on reverse engineering. Visit com/find on a browser and log in to your Google account. If you have multiple devices, select the missing device from the list. Youll see the devices approximate location on the map. And since the lost phone is dead, youll get its last recorded location, if available.
Once they have a warrant, the police can access a phones GPS data through a cell provider and view its current or last known location. Police and cell providers can track any phone that is connected to a cellular network in real time unless the phone is dead or turned off.

Its a good idea to make sure youve enabled location services on your phone and provided Google with permission to trace your phone location. To do so, head to Settings Google. Hit Find My Device and toggle it on to enable tracking.
Find My Device is another Google app to track a cell phone location for free. It runs only on Android devices. Most tracker apps powered by Google are designed for locating lost phones but can also track location with pinpoint accuracy. Download and the app on the target device.
To find a lost phone that is switched off; Go to Android.com/find on your web browser. Sign in with the Google account connected to the lost device. The device will be displayed at the top of the screen. Click the lost phone, its last location will be displayed on the map.
If youre using iCloud.com/find, you cant see your devices location if its powered off, the battery has run out, or more than 24 hours has passed since its last location was sent to Apple. Learn how you can still protect your information.
